Producing Kombucha Extract brings together the long tradition of fermentation and modern extraction technology. Fermentation always requires a careful mix of tea, sugar, and a healthy SCOBY, or symbiotic culture of bacteria and yeast. Once the right level of fermentation is achieved, the liquid carries a full spectrum of organic acids, vitamins, polyphenols, and beneficial metabolites. Our extraction process separates these valuable compounds in a way that preserves their original balance without introducing synthetic additives. Each batch is checked to keep the nutrient profile consistent and to avoid the bitterness that sometimes mars less refined extracts.
The raw kombucha enters our stainless-steel extractors directly from fermentation tanks. Only food-grade solvents and low-temperature processing are used, which means the fragile polyphenols and vitamins stay intact. Volatile organics are carefully collected, not lost to evaporation. We measure acidity, color, and content of bioactive compounds in-house so each run meets the same biological activity as the fresh drink, only in a much more concentrated form.

Once concentrated, kombucha extract provides the signature organic acids — acetic, gluconic, lactic — that form during proper fermentation. These support functional claims such as digestive support and skin health. Unlike a simple vinegar or tea extract, kombucha contains a diversity of metabolites produced by multiple strains of yeast and bacteria acting in concert.

Raw materials set the baseline for a strong kombucha extract — using stale, low-grade tea or inconsistent sugar results in unpredictable ferments. Suppliers often request cost savings by substituting refined sugar or tea dust, but those bring unwanted off-notes and a limited bioactive profile. We stick to whole, graded tea leaves and cane sugar for their impact on finished extract quality. Managing cost here cuts issues at later stages.
Controlling microbial purity during fermentation proves key. Wild contaminants thrive in a poorly controlled tank environment or when fermenters aren’t cleaned regularly. We leverage starter strains validated by third-party genetics tests to guard against unexpected yeasts or molds. In-process checks for pH, sugar drop, and temperature are backed up by periodic sample plating. Once fermented to target acidity, tanks transfer directly for extraction without holding days, which can degrade the intended active mix.

New research into fermentation shows kombucha extracts carry activity beyond simple organic acids. Teas rich in catechins and the presence of fermentation-derived vitamins, such as B-group cofactors, end up at bioavailable concentrations in the extract. This complexity proves difficult for companies relying strictly on non-fermented alternatives or quick-brew techniques. We orient our next generation extract development toward broadening the active spectrum, running ongoing trials with special tea varietals and non-traditional fermentation substrates such as rooibos or hibiscus.
